Marquise Goodwin Dealing With A Groin Injury
Marquise Goodwin (groin) didn't practice Wednesday due to a groin injury. He was set for a more prominent role in Week 8 with DK Metcalf (knee) and Tyler Lockett (hamstring) dealing with injuries. Metcalf and Lockett were both active, and Goodwin was utilized as Seattle's WR3 in last Sunday's win over the Giants. The 31-year-old had four catches (on five targets) for 33 yards. Goodwin has two more chances to log a full practice ahead of Sunday's game. Goodwin is mainly an option in deep-league formats against the Cardinals in Week 9.
